Output aa58f156785be80c359588d9ad2f89567c5d029e32d2e65f4eea10895bdd0330:0

value
658659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04ac2ead22db90ff725caddfcdf468d0df7e0303 OP_EQUALVERIFY OP_CHECKSIG
address
1RhyCud6Pv9tDKWBNFu6WnrMiNCbEveTt
transaction
aa58f156785be80c359588d9ad2f89567c5d029e32d2e65f4eea10895bdd0330
spent
true